Transaction 34616f35177390eabd1b409813175e97cc74b058f0e9a1b72cf79f830a3e52ca
1 Input
2 Outputs
- 34616f35177390eabd1b409813175e97cc74b058f0e9a1b72cf79f830a3e52ca:0
- 34616f35177390eabd1b409813175e97cc74b058f0e9a1b72cf79f830a3e52ca:1
value 12850000
address 1DeFeb6fTuQWHJweLZZKfHuGKpg8ZMUSZd
value 742035313
address 15naPQfXLswJpZBBbN68KxBPMn4UcpoVcC